Albany, Moran athletes head to FCA games
By Melinda L. Lucas
A trio of senior athletes – two from Albany and one from Moran – will represent their two schools at the 2025 Big Country FCA All-Star Festival taking place this week in Abilene and Brownwood.
Albany’s Abi Hale is slated to take the court in the Bev Ball All-Star Volleyball Classic, which begins at 7 p.m. Thursday, June 5, at Moody Coliseum on the Abilene Christian University campus.
Her classmate Myleigh Leveridge has been chosen as a member of the FCA all-star cheerleading team and will cheer at the volleyball game, both basketball games, and on the sidelines of the 26th annual Myrle Greathouse All-Star Football Classic, scheduled for 10 a.m. Saturday, June 7, at Shotwell Stadium in Abilene.
Ellis Hise, a senior from Moran, will suit up for the boys’ all-star basketball matchup at 7 p.m. Friday, June 6, also at Moody Coliseum. The girls’ game will precede it at 5 p.m.
Though selected for the festival, three additional Albany athletes will not be participating. Landon Balliew had earned a spot on the football team, while Chip Chambers was named to the all-star baseball. Caroline Holson was picked for the girls’ basketball game.
The Big Country FCA All-Star Festival brings together outstanding senior athletes from across the region to compete in a range of sports — including football, volleyball, basketball, baseball, softball, and cheerleading. The events are free to attend and focus on both athletic talent and the values of Christian fellowship and sportsmanship.
